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Adirondack foundation, founded in 1997 as adirondack community trust, strengthens community through philanthropy. Its vision is that against a backdrop of scenic beauty, our communities are strong, just and inclusive; family wellbeing is supported through quality healthcare, education, and economic opportunity; nature is valued and protected; and arts and culture thrive.

Enhancing the lives of people in the adirondacks through philanthropy.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

Upon receiving the 990 and nys char 500 returns electronically from the preparers, the chief financial officer and administration email the 990 and nys char 500 to the audit committee for their review and approval. Once approved by the audit committee, the board members receive the returns and have one week to review before the returns are filed.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Each member of the board of trustees, advisory council, community fund committee, scholarship committee and staff must sign a statement that affirms that they have received and read the conflict of interest policy, list any potential conflicts and that they have not received any compensation, grants or other assistance from adirondack foundation.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

The board of trustees of adirondack foundation will conduct a formal review of the president & ceo on an annual basis. All necessary salary comparables, salary range recommendations, and staff support will be obtained and provided as needed. 1) annually, the president & ceo prepares a self-assessment based upon organizational and professional goals. Results are sent to the board chair. The board chair and executive committee evaluate the assessment. 2) a meeting is held with the president & ceo and chair of the board to discuss performance and salary adjustments (if any) and fringe benefits. Because the budget is presented at the may trustee meeting, the president & ceo's salary information will be available by the may meeting and will be entered into the minutes. An executive session will be held by all trustees discussing the performance benefits and salary. 3) after a final decision is made, all documents regarding performance and salary adjustments will be kept in the personnel files and recorded in the minutes along with a committee signed salary and benefit authorization. The president & ceo is required to conduct an annual performance review of each staff. The results will be kept in the personnel files.

IRS990/Desc0ADIRONDACK FOUNDATION PLAYS A UNIQUE ROLE IN THE REGION BY 1) STEWARDING CHARITABLE ASSETS FROM GENEROUS PEOPLE WHO CARE ABOUT THE AREA AND WANT TO MAKE A DIFFERENCE, 2) MAKING GRANTS TO NONPROFITS, SCHOOLS, AND MUNICIPALITIES, AND 3) SERVING AS A COMMUNITY LEADER. THE FOUNDATION VALUES COLLABORATION, ACCOUNTABILITY, INCLUSION, DIVERSITY, AND COMPASSION IN ITS WORK. IT STEWARDS MORE THAN 250 CHARITABLE FUNDS AND ITS PRIMARY GRANTMAKING AREAS ARE: EDUCATION, COMMUNITY VITALITY, ECONOMIC OPPORTUNITY, ENVIRONMENT, HUMAN WELL-BEING, AND ARTS AND CULTURE. ITS LEADERSHIP WORK INCLUDES ESTABLISHING THE ADIRONDACK NONPROFIT NETWORK, HELPING TO DEVELOP THE ADIRONDACK COMMON GROUND ALLIANCE, AND COORDINATING THE ADIRONDACK BIRTH TO THREE ALLIANCE.
